A method, system, and computer-readable storage medium for assisted parking of a vehicle (100) are described. The method comprising obtaining (710) data associated with a surrounding of the vehicle (100), identify (720) in the data a set of candidate parking spaces (330a, 330b) for the vehicle (100) which meet at least one criterion associated with the vehicle (100), selecting (730) one parking space for parking the vehicle (100) out of the set, obtaining (760) data associated with the surrounding of the selected parking space (330a), determining (770) whether the selected parking space (330a, 330b) meets the at least one criterion based on the data associated with the surrounding of the selected parking space (330a, 330b) and if the selected parking space (330a, 330b) is determined to meet the at least one criterion performing (780) a parking maneuver, otherwise selecting (790) another parking space out of the set.
